Are you looking for a rewarding career within Refrigeration and HVAC If so you may be the perfect fit for the Senior Technician Refrigeration/HVAC position at Walmart!

As a Sr Technician Refrigeration/HVAC you will be responsible for leading and participating in teams in Facilities Management- HVAC/R by using and sharing resources information and tools. You will be determining customer needs and business priorities coordinating and executing work assignments and providing advice feedback and support to ensure timelines and work quality are achieved. You will also be modeling and helping others with how to adapt to change or new challenge and developing relationships with HVAC/R parts suppliers and contractors.

Youll make an impact by

  • Overseeing and implementing special projects for field operations by collecting data.

  • Evaluating new technology capabilities and correcting deficiencies.

  • Providing suggestions for changes and improvements.

  • Providing required paperwork by completing forms (for example expense vouchers weekly summaries refrigerant logs work orders) and submitting to senior leadership.

  • Ensuring compliance with applicable Occupational Safety and Health Administration and Environmental Protection Agency regulations and guidelines by performing work according to practices and procedures outlined in the Walmart heating ventilation air conditioning and refrigeration (HVAC/R) safety policy and environmental guidelines; and reclaiming ozone-depleting refrigerants.

  • Ensuring compliance with applicable federal state and local HVAC/R industry regulations and guidelines (for example building codes indoor air quality cold chain requirements) by conducting inspections; and making repairs.

  • Maintains quality standards by inspecting installations and modifications of new HVAC/R equipment and Energy Management Systems (EMS); ensuring contract compliance; and identifying and reporting deficiencies.

  • Ensuring available resources for HVAC/R maintenance and repair by managing refrigerant levels and parts inventory.

  • Recording HVAC/R purchases and usage and tracking and ordering HVAC/R parts.

  • Ensuring financial sustainability by compiling and reporting budget information to the regional manager of Facilities and requesting replacement HVAC/R equipment for facilities.

  • Submitting warranty claims reviewing journals and invoices conducting price comparisons of refrigerant parts and travel related costs and developing scopes of work for projects (for example rooftop units condenser coil replacements).

  • Providing training (for example safety control troubleshooting oil system operation and adjustment) by traveling to company facilities for on-site sessions.

  • Performing on-site HVAC/R repairs for hands-on learning evaluating the technician skill sets and reporting back to senior leadership.

  • Ensuring working order of HVAC/R and EMS and direct digital control equipment by troubleshooting diagnosing maintaining and repairing equipment.

  • Performing major and minor preventive maintenance.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• Completion of a 2-year technical/vocational HVAC/R program or 2-year associates of applied science A/C and refrigeration

  • 10 years experience in HVAC/grocery rack refrigeration OR 8 years experience in HVAC/grocery rack refrigeration and AAS in A/C and Refrigeration.

  • Universal EPA Certification

  • Must have a valid Drivers License
